logo

Output 6cb3eb90fb17351cc64e42c2560a12440125c959420ddc286ca6ef74c689d5ac:0

value
7575904
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e26b68186f4cdc0023a974b7aabfdd3f60f7751c OP_EQUALVERIFY OP_CHECKSIG
address
1MeCP6cAgJbPQzSxF2A31XveRUZkXWq8P2
transaction
6cb3eb90fb17351cc64e42c2560a12440125c959420ddc286ca6ef74c689d5ac